A reverse isoperimetric inequality for the Cheeger constant under width constraint
Henrot and Lucardesi, in Commun. Contemp. Math. (2024), conjectured that among planar convex sets with prescribed minimal width, the equilateral triangle uniquely maximizes the Cheeger constant. In this short note, we confirm this conjecture. Moreover, we establish a stability result for the inequality in terms of the Hausdorff distance.
